Ozempic and Lexapro reddit The burgeoning use of semaglutide for weight management has brought to light questions about its interactions with other commonly prescribed medications, particularly antidepressants. As a GLP-1 agonist medication, semaglutide, known by brand names like Ozempic and Wegovy, works by mimicking a natural hormone to help regulate blood sugar and promote satiety, leading to weight loss. Simultaneously, many individuals managing their weight may also be taking antidepressant medications to address mental health conditions such as depression and anxiety. This has led to a crucial area of inquiry: how do these two classes of drugs interact, and what are the potential implications for patient care?

The interaction between semaglutide and SSRIs may be influenced by both pharmacokinetic (how the body processes the drugs) and pharmacodynamic (how the drugs affect the body) mechanisms. Furthermore, both Ozempic and sertraline can independently cause gastrointestinal (GI) side effects, such as n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ea. When taken together, the likelihood or severity of these GI side effects may be amplified.

For individuals taking specific antidepressants, additional considerations may apply. For example, therapy with SNRI antidepressants (Serotonin and Norepinephrine Reuptake Inhibitors) like Cymbalta can cause activation of mania and hypomania and should be used with caution in patients with a personal or family history of these conditions. While Drug Interaction Report: Cymbalta, semaglutide might not show a direct pharmacological clash, the underlying psychiatric conditions and potential for mood changes require careful monitoring.
Moreover, there is ongoing research into the broader impact of GLP-1 agonists on mood. Previous pharmacovigilance analyses have detected a potential signal linking semaglutide to reports of depression and suicidal ideation. While this is an area of concern and requires further investigation, it's important to differentiate between the drug's direct effects and the underlying conditions of patients.
